Author, Historian, Art Collector, Actress, Musician and Composer. Anne is best known for her contributions to all projects related to the famous artist Tamara de Lempicka. In the last 29 years her research on the life and art of Tamara de Lempicka has led to major contributions to the documentary "The True Story of Tamara de Lempicka and the Art of Survival" written and directed by award winning director Julie Rubio. Her credits include cast (herself), research consulting and photographic contributions. Anne's first book "Tamara de Lempicka. Behind the Scenes" (ENG) and "Tamara Lempicka. Za Kulisami" (POL) is published by BOSZ Szymanik. Other film credits are contributing photography archivist for the film docudrama "Tamara de Lempicka - Queen of Art Déco", 2022, authored and directed by Sylvie Kürsten and produced by Nordend Film GmbH, Hamburg, Germany for broadcast on NDR/arte (ARTE.TV), and featured collector, consultant and photo contributor to "Tamara Lempicka - Traces", directed by Agnieszka Lipiec-Wroblewska to be released in 2024. She has worked in many facets of the music business including being a Hammond Organ Concert Artist and has won awards as a performer and in national songwriting competitions. Annie's Music, her retail store located in Rochester Hills, Michigan is the main set location for the short film "Do You Want to Buy a Landline" (2024), written and produced by Lee Cleaveland. Anne appears in "Do You Want to Buy a Landline - Director's Cut" (2024) as herself.
